I think those numbers are somewhat skewed as well because of Georgia techs option offense being mostly run and the fact that our offense could not sustain drives leading to our defense being out of it early. I think our defense is actually better than the numbers show and can prove it if the offense gets them off the field long enough. Just an opinion though.

The GATech team that averaged 307 rushing yards per game last year but hung 655 on us? That GATech team? Doesn’t that validate just how horrific our run defense was?

Btw, Missouri, a passing team that averaged 193 yards rushing per game went for 430+ on us last year. 4-7 Vanderbilt ran for 246 yards while we ran for 55 on them.....246 doesn’t sound crazy until you realize they were dead last in rushing offense in 2017, averaging 107 yards per game.
